Загрузка...

BAS How to call another function if the first one received Fail?

Thread in Private Keeper, BAS, OB created by iwosafmhi2bn Apr 22, 2024. 153 views

  1. iwosafmhi2bn
    iwosafmhi2bn Topic starter Apr 22, 2024 2 Dec 26, 2023
    У меня есть 5 функций он должен отработать всех
    К примеру в первую функцию он получил ответ Fail он должен переходить ко второй как это реализовать ?
     
    1. KusuriYakuzen
  2. противоположник
    Python
    def function1():
    result = call_function1() # тут вызывается твоя первая функция
    if result == "Fail":
    function2()

    def function2():
    result = call_function2() # тут вызывается твоя вторая функция
    if result == "Fail":
    function3()

    def function3():
    result = call_function3() # тут вызывается твоя третья функция
    if result == "Fail":
    function4()

    def function4():
    result = call_function4() # тут вызывается твоя четвертая функция
    if result == "Fail":
    function5()

    def function5():
    result = call_function5() # тут вызывается твоя пятая функция
     
    1. iwosafmhi2bn Topic starter
    2. противоположник
      iwosafmhi2bn, 
      JS
      function function1() {
      var result = call_function1(); // тут вызывается твоя первая функция
      if (result === "Fail") {
      function2();
      }
      }


      function function2() {
      var result = call_function2(); // тут вызывается твоя вторая функция
      if (result === "Fail") {
      function3();
      }
      }


      function function3() {
      var result = call_function3(); // тут вызывается твоя третья функция
      if (result === "Fail") {
      function4();
      }
      }


      function function4() {
      var result = call_function4(); // тут вызывается твоя четвертая функция
      if (result === "Fail") {
      function5();
      }
      }


      function function5() {
      var result = call_function5(); // тут вызывается твоя пятая функция
      }

  3. 3645483
    3645483 Apr 22, 2024 4354 Nov 6, 2020
    на действии вызова функции справа сверху давани на треугольничек
     
  4. ftyhp
    Fail предназначен для остановки потока. Для того чтобы он перезапускался, нужно поставить скрипт на повторение. Тебе подойдёт return скорее
     
Loading...
Top